False-Friend Alerts

Talkparty flags the cognates that trick English speakers — embarazada, éxito, sensible, actualmente, asistir — with the natural Spanish alternative and an example.

Castilian or Latin American Vocabulary

Pick your variant and Talkparty tunes the vocabulary accordingly: ordenador vs computadora, coche vs carro, vosotros vs ustedes, móvil vs celular.

Learn Collocations, Not Just Words

Knowing 'decisión' isn't enough — you need 'tomar una decisión'. Talkparty teaches the chunks natives use, so your Spanish stops sounding translated.

Common Myths About Building Spanish Vocabulary

Myth

I just need to memorize more flashcards.

Reality

Recognizing 'embarazada' on a flashcard doesn't stop you from using it the wrong way in real life. Active production in conversation is what shifts vocabulary from passive to active — flashcards alone keep you stuck.

Myth

I can learn vocabulary without picking a regional variant.

Reality

Mixing 'ordenador' with 'celular' or 'vosotros' with 'ustedes' marks you as a learner immediately. Picking Castilian or Latin American Spanish from the start makes your vocabulary internally consistent.

Myth

Cognates make Spanish vocabulary easy.

Reality

Cognates help with recognition but hide false friends. Without context, you don't know which English-looking words are safe and which embarrass you. Talkparty flags the dangerous ones.
